Book Review " One Second After"

Hello Beloved,

I have finished reading this new book. It was an eye opener too. It was fiction but like the last book I read it was based on true facts. The book is called:
" One Second After" by William R. Forstchen. It has a foreword by Newt
Gingrich. I think it is something we should all know about at least.
The subject is EMP: Electromagnetic Pulse Weapon.

The book is about a man who lives in mountains of North Carolina and how when this weapon is used it sends the entire country back into the Dark Ages.

They take it out to see the reason for all the stopped cars... He tries to start his own car and nothing. Being a retired military man he has an idea of what has happened.... EMP.
This weapon works like this: when an atomic bomb is detonated about the earth's atmosphere it can generate a " pulse wave" which travels at the speed of light and will short- circuit EVERY electronic device that the wave touches on the earth's surface...( taken from the Foreword by Newt Gingrich).
So, now with nothing electronic working, anything that is run by computers, ie: lights , all medical equipment, refrigeration, ect.... What will happen?
War breaks out within the community , looting, shooting, food shortage, death.
